Christopher Rawson 1712–1780 – Genealogical Records

Birth Date: 31 Jul 1712

Birth Location: Calverley, Yorkshire, England

Death Date: 12 Aug 1780

Death Location: Stoney Royd, Halifax Yorkshire

Father: John Rawson

Mother: Katherine Lister

Spouse(s): Grace Rawson

Children(s): John Rawson

The story of Christopher Rawson began in 1712 in Calverley, Yorkshire, England. Christopher Rawson married Grace Rawson, and had children including John Rawson. Christopher Rawson passed away in 1780 in Stoney Royd, Halifax Yorkshire.
